Building Boost: Difference between revisions

From pCT
(Created page with "Version used: Boost-v1.7 with Python3 support <syntaxhighlight lang="bash"> $ wget https://dl.bintray.com/boostorg/release/1.70.0/source/boost_1_70_0.tar.gz $ tar xvf boost_...")
 
mNo edit summary
 
Line 2: Line 2:


<syntaxhighlight lang="bash">
<syntaxhighlight lang="bash">
$ wget https://dl.bintray.com/boostorg/release/1.70.0/source/boost_1_70_0.tar.gz
$ wget https://netix.dl.sourceforge.net/project/boost/boost/1.70.0/boost_1_70_0.tar.gz


$ tar xvf boost_1_70_0.tar.gz  
$ tar xvf boost_1_70_0.tar.gz  

Latest revision as of 11:16, 28 March 2020

Version used: Boost-v1.7 with Python3 support

$ wget https://netix.dl.sourceforge.net/project/boost/boost/1.70.0/boost_1_70_0.tar.gz

$ tar xvf boost_1_70_0.tar.gz 

$ cd boost_1_70_0/

$ ./bootstrap.sh --prefix=/opt/boost-v1.7-python3 --with-python=/usr/bin/python3

$ sudo ./b2 install --prefix=/opt/boost-v1.7-python3 --with=all -j4

Remember to add Boost details to your environment, e.g. /etc/bashrc:

export LD_LIBRARY_PATH=/opt/boost-v1.7-python3/lib:$LD_LIBRARY_PATH

export CPLUS_INCLUDE_PATH=/opt/boost-v1.7-python3/include:$CPLUS_INCLUDE_PATH

export PYTHONPATH=/opt/boost-v1.7-python3/lib:$PYTHONPATH